在数字化时代,区块链技术以其去中心化、安全性高、透明度强的特点,逐渐成为金融科技领域的一颗耀眼新星,而与之紧密相关的概念——区块链钱包开发,也逐渐成为了业界关注的焦点,啥叫区块链钱包开发呢?

区块链钱包,顾名思义,是指用于存储、管理和交易区块链上数字资产(如比特币、以太坊等)的软件应用,而区块链钱包开发,则是指为用户设计和实现这一软件应用的过程。
区块链钱包开发主要包括以下几个步骤:
需求分析:了解用户需求,确定钱包的功能、安全性和易用性等方面的要求。
设计方案:根据需求分析,设计钱包的架构、界面和交互流程。
选择技术栈:根据设计方案,选择合适的编程语言、框架和工具,如Java、Python、Solidity等。
编码实现:按照设计方案,进行钱包的核心功能开发,包括钱包创建、导入、导出、转账、收款、交易记录查询等。
安全性测试:对钱包进行安全性测试,确保其能够抵御各种攻击,如DDoS攻击、钓鱼攻击等。
性能优化:对钱包进行性能优化,提高其运行速度和稳定性。
用户界面设计:设计简洁、美观、易用的用户界面,提升用户体验。
部署上线:将钱包部署到服务器,确保其能够稳定运行。
区块链钱包开发过程中,需要特别注意以下几个方面:
安全性:钱包的安全性至关重要,要确保用户资产的安全,防止黑客攻击和恶意软件。
易用性:钱包要易于使用,让用户能够快速上手,方便进行各种操作。
用户体验:注重用户体验,设计简洁、美观、直观的界面,提高用户满意度。
跨平台兼容性:支持多种操作系统,如Windows、macOS、Linux等,方便用户在不同设备上使用。
技术更新:紧跟区块链技术发展趋势,不断优化钱包功能,提升用户体验。
区块链钱包开发是一个涉及多个领域、多个环节的复杂过程,只有充分考虑用户需求、注重安全性、易用性和用户体验,才能打造出优秀的区块链钱包产品,在我国金融科技迅速发展的背景下,区块链钱包开发将成为未来金融领域的重要一环。